Let us look at a few statistics that showcase the growth of D2C ecommerce:

  • 63% of consumers prefer to buy directly from brands, indicating a significant customer pull towards the D2C model
  • 65% of B2B companies now offer e-commerce capabilities, a foundational step towards exploring or expanding into D2C sales
  • 89% retention rate of companies that implement strong omnichannel strategies
  • 20-30% boost in margins for B2B companies implementing a D2C model by cutting out retailer markups
  • 65% of B2B companies now offer e-commerce capabilities, exploring or expanding into D2C sales

Source: PWC, McKinsey, Statista

2. Will the ecommerce ecosystem support customised pricing and discounts for different buyer groups?

Custom pricing is crucial for B2B brands as bulk buyers expect negotiated rates, while D2C customers respond better to seasonal deals and coupons. You need a flexible pricing engine that helps serve both segments effectively.

4. Does the enterprise ecommerce solution allow flexible payment options suitable for both B2B and D2C buyers?

B2B clients often require credit terms, invoices, or net payment options, while D2C buyers want instant payments and wallets. An ecommerce ecosystem that supports varied payment modes helps ensure smooth order completion for both customer types.
